EASY SLOW COOKER CHILI CONEY DOGS
Slow Cooker Chili Coney Dogs are so simple to make in the slow cooker! Hot dogs and the savory ground beef meat sauce cook together in the crock pot. Serve in hot dog buns and top with shredded cheese and finely diced white onion.
Provided by Jessica
Categories Main Course
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a skillet pan cook ground beef, over medium high heat, for 6-8 minutes or until no longer pink. Crumble the ground beef as you cook it. Drain excess grease.
- Add the tomato sauce, water, Worcestershire sauce, dried minced onion, garlic powder, ground mustard, chili powder, black pepper, and cayenne pepper if using. Stir together and let it simmer while you prepare the hot dogs.
- Spray the insert of a slow cooker with cooking spray. Lay the hot dogs on the bottom. Pour the ground beef meat sauce over top the hot dogs. Cook on LOW heat for 3-5 hours. * I use turkey hot dogs and they don't need to cook as long. Mine are done just shy of 3 hours. Either turkey dogs or all beef hot dogs can be used in this recipe.
- When cook time is done serve the chili Coney dogs inside hot dog buns and top with some ground beef chili mixture (I use a slotted spoon when serving the chili). Top with shredded cheese, onion, and relish if wanted.*When I have time, I place the hot dog buns in a 9x13 baking dish and put a hot dog in each bun. I then use a slotted spoon to put some chili on top of each dog. Sprinkle with shredded cheese and white onion. I broil it on high (watch closely!) for just a few minutes.

CHILI CONEY DOGS
From the youngest kids to the oldest adults, everyone in our family loves these hot dogs. Inspired by the classic Coney dog, they're so easy to throw together in the morning or even the night before. -Michele Harris, Vicksburg, Michigan
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Lunch
Time 4h20m
Yield 8 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large skillet, cook beef over medium heat until no longer pink, 6-8 minutes, breaking into crumbles; drain. Stir in tomato sauce, water, Worcestershire sauce, onion and seasonings., Place hot dogs in a 3-qt. slow cooker; top with beef mixture. Cook, covered, on low 4-5 hours or until heated through. Serve on buns with toppings as desired.

ORIGINAL CONEY ISLAND CHILI
Make and share this Original Coney Island Chili rec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Timothy H.
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 1h15m
Yield 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Brown ground chuck in a skillet. Drain approximately half the residual oil. Add ground pepperoni and grated onion and brown for another minute or two.
- 2.
- combine in kosher salt, brown sugar, chili powder, cumin, celery seed, cayenne and combine to meat mixture.
- 3.
- Reduce heat and add tomato paste, liquid smoke and V8 juice and bring to a simmer.
- 4.
- When chili has come to a low bubbling simmer, add cornmeal and cook low and slow for another 15 minutes.
- 5.
- Ladle over hotdogs or grilled burgers. This is a welcome sauce for grated sharp cheddar cheese and minced onions, but a true Coney Dog uses classic yellow mustard and a sprinkling of onions.

GRANDPA'S CLASSIC CONEY SAUCE
My Grandfather owned a drive-in restaurant back in the 1950's. This is his exact recipe for Coney Dogs from back in the day. I make this on special occasions and it is always hit with friends and family. Enjoy.
Provided by Sean S.
Categories Side Dish Sauces and Condiments Recipes Sauce Recipes
Time 2h10m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Place the ground beef and onion in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ook, stirring to crumble, until beef is browned. Drain. Transfer the beef and onion to a slow cooker and stir in the ketchup, sugar, vinegar and mustard. Season with celery seed, Worcestershire sauce, pepper and salt. Cover and simmer on Low setting for a few hours before serving.
